A question about : Overpayment on Endowment or Repayment
We have a mortgage of Ј96,000,
Ј75,000 is on an endowment basis and
Ј21,000 is on a repayment basis.
Interest rate is 5.49% on both.
We have Ј7,000 to make an overpayment.
Can anyone advise whether it would be more efficient to pay off capital from the endowment or the repayment. Or does it not matter?
Best answers:
- Do you know how your Endowment Policy is performing?
Is it on track to give you Ј75,000? If it is then put it to the repayment.
But as you are not reducing your Endowment part you are always paying intrest on the total amount so logically it would make sense to make the overpayment on that.
